Again this morning we got up at 7am. We started the day with an Amarula coffee and rusks. We drove to the Jacana Hide. Along the way we saw the largest bird in the world – an ostrich. At the hide we saw many types of weavers, but not much else.

As we drove back towards camp we saw a journey of giraffe. There were four of them. We stayed and watched them for a little bit. Back at camp we had toasted jaffles for breakfast and then packed up. I wish we could have stayed here for longer. It has been a relaxing trip. Next time I would like to do more of the walking trails.

A few hours later we were back in Johannesburg. That evening we had a fun night out, starting with bowling and then a delicious meal at a Japanese restaurant. Later on we dropped Neil and Claudine at his brother Stuart's house and said goodbye to them.
